> I just decided to try BtrFS for the first time, to replace an old ReiserFS 
> data partition currently on a mdadm mirror. To do so, I'm using two 3 TB 
> disks that were initially detected as sdd and sde, on which I have a 
> single large GPT partition, so the devices I'm using for btrfs are sdd1 
> and sde1.
> 
> I created a filesystem on them using RAID1 from the start (mkfs.btrfs -d 
> raid -m raid1 /dev/sd{d,e}1), and started copying the data from the old 
> partition onto it during the night. As it happened, I immediately got 
> reason to try out BtrFS recovery because sometime during the copying 
> operation /dev/sdd had some kind of cable failure and was removed from the 
> system. A while later, however, it was apparently auto-redetected, this 
> time as /dev/sdi, and BtrFS seems to have inserted it back into the 
> filesystem somehow.

> Also, why does it say that the errors are occuring /dev/sdd1? Is it just 
> remembering the whole filesystem by that name since that's how I mounted 
> it, or is it still trying to access the old removed instance of that disk 
> and is that, then, why it's giving all these errors?

You started the balance after above btrfs fi show command?

Then its obvious to me:

For some reason BTRFS is still trying to write to /dev/sdd, which isn´t
there anymore. That perfectly explains those lost page writes for me. If
that is the case, this seems to me like a serious bug in BTRFS.

Also Hugo´s obversation point in that direction. At first I would take those
log messages literally. 

There is a chance that BTRFS still displays /dev/sdd while actually writing
to /dev/sdi, but, I doubt it. I think its possible to find this out by
using iostat -x 1 or atop or something like that. And if it does write to
the correct device file, I think it makes sense to update and fix those
log messages.

I´d restart the machine, see that BTRFS is using both devices again and
then try the balance again.

I´d do this while still having a backup on the ReiserFS volume or another
backup drive. After this I´d do a btrfs scrub start to see whether BTRFS
is happy with all the data on the drives.
